
To Hawaii, with Love
by Michael P. Spradlin
Hawaii, here I come! So, it turns out I'm this reincarnated goddess. Whatever "that" means. Of course, being a goddess apparently doesn't come with perfect hair or decent skin or even any neat-o superpowers. Nope. Apparently the only thing I get for being a goddess is one stark-raving mad nemesis -- in this case, the old bull god Mithras, or at least this lunatic named Simon Blankenship, who thinks he's the present-day reincarnation of Mithras. And the only thing standing between him and total world domination? Oh, right: me. As if! So now we have to find these seven talismans of power before he does. On the plus side, it turns out that one of them is in Hawaii . . . and hey, I bet we could fit some surfing in around saving the world, right? Well, a goddess has got to do what a goddess has got to do!
